
小程序
菜鸟历程
iOS开发交流群:301058503
展开
-
小程序开发——问小程序为何物?
前段时间,由于公司的需要,做了两年半的iOS开发的我,带着对iOS无比的眷恋,踏上了小程序的开发历程。何为小程序 小程序是由腾讯出品,依附于微信的一款轻应用。 有人说,小程序不需要下载即可使用,其实不然,它是需要下载的。因为它是一种轻应用(体积小,小程序本身规定了大小不能超过4M),所以体积小,下载时间很短而已。我试过在小程序的工程里面放了1M多的图片,然后第一次打开的速度明显下降了。 ...原创 2018-04-22 11:34:32 · 331 阅读 · 0 评论 -
小程序开发——默认的下拉小圆点
小程序系统提供了下拉刷新时的动画,有三个小圆点。但是有时候我们发现不见了。其实它一直都在,只是因为你的页面的背景色和白色很相近甚至相同,而小程序小圆点默认的颜色就是白色,所以看不见注意以下三点:在需要下拉的页面的 .json 文件添加 “enablePullDownRefresh”: true 。如果你的页面的背景色和白色相差明显,那么你下拉时就已经可以看见小圆点了;如果你的页面的背景色...原创 2018-12-10 16:14:17 · 1210 阅读 · 0 评论 -
小程序开发——页面背景色设置
在小程序开发的前期,你可能发现小程序的页面背景色设置总是无法成功,特别是在有列表的页面,下拉或者上拉时,漏出来的地方和原来的背景色不一样。要设置成一样,注意以下两点在 app.json 文件里面的 window 添加 backgroundColor在 app.wxss 文件里吗添加(注意,page 的前面没有 . )page { background-color: #efeff4;...原创 2018-12-10 16:05:15 · 15608 阅读 · 1 评论 -
小程序开发——自定义下拉刷新和上拉加载更多
小程序的下拉刷新和上拉加载更多,系统已经提供方法。我这里就是利用系统的方法,用自定义的UI和动画去实现。第一步想要利用系统的方法,首先要开启。开启方法:在相应的.json文件里面添加”enablePullDownRefresh”: true(当然,这个是默认开启的,如果发现无法使用时,就手动再开启一次)第二步需要在相应的.wxss文件添加加载动画的样式.weui-l...原创 2018-05-22 09:32:34 · 18224 阅读 · 4 评论 -
小程序开发——网络请求
普通的数据请求wx.request({ url: '',//地址 method: 'POST',//请求方式POST,GET data: param,//参数,key-value键值对 success: function (res) { console.log(res); }, error: function (res) {...原创 2018-04-26 00:14:32 · 917 阅读 · 0 评论 -
小程序开发——tabbar
小程序的tabbar使用比较简单,只需要在app.json文件里面加上下面的tabbar数组即可"tabBar": {//未选择的颜色 "color": "#AAAAAA", //选中的颜色 "selectedColor": "原创 2018-04-25 23:59:35 · 1855 阅读 · 0 评论 -
小程序开发——页面跳转及传值
小程序的页面跳转有几种方式wx.navigateTo({ url: ‘personalInfo/personalInfo’, }) url为下一个页面的路径 如果要传值的话,可直接在url后面加上,如 wx.navigateTo({ url: ‘personalInfo/personalInfo?pageid=10&pagename=B’, }) 在下一个页面...原创 2018-04-22 19:17:17 · 2417 阅读 · 0 评论 -
小程序开发——常用布局
小程序的布局分为两类:横向布局和纵向布局横向布局 从左到右 如: .wxss文件.rowLayout { display: flex; flex-direction: row;}.wxml (views是我在.json定义的数组,有四个元素)<view class='rowLayout'> &am原创 2018-04-22 14:57:10 · 23727 阅读 · 2 评论 -
小程序开发——文件目录
上一篇我简单地介绍了一下小程序,现在我来介绍一下小程序工程里面的文件及其作用先看一下小程序工程的界面,如下图 左边是模拟器,中间是文件目录,右边是具体的文件的内容。我们主要看中间的文件pages pages文件夹下面的是页面相关的文件,home这个是我新建的一个页面。新建一个page时,会产生4个文件 .js文件:其实就相当于APP的controller,里面包括data(页面...原创 2018-04-22 12:12:49 · 3726 阅读 · 0 评论 -
小程序开发——点击的背景色
为某个控件添加按下的颜色在 .wxss 文件添加.jz_hover { background-color: lightgray;}在需要添加按下样式的控件添加 hover-class=‘jz_hover’ 。如果没有变化,那么可能是 style 里面设置了背景色,需要把 style 里面的背景色设置放到 class 里面去。...原创 2018-12-10 16:37:40 · 1538 阅读 · 0 评论